TEGAM T emperature Sta bilized Coaxial Po wer Standards enable precise measurement of microwave power in the
0.1 MHz to 26.5 GHz frequency range. All units are extremely rugged, highly accurate, stable with time and temperature, and ideal for use as standards for the transfer of calibration factors to other standards and power meters. Units are supplied with calibration data traceable to NIST with Z540 data standard.
All models are designed for use with dc self balancing bridges or controllers such as the TEGAM Model 1806 Dual Type IV Power Meter and the Model 1805B RF Power Level Control Unit. System configurations employing instruments of this extreme accuracy typically achieve results in the transfer of calibration factors normally found only in primary standards laboratories (refer to System IIA data sheet).
Models F1116, F1119, F1109 and F1117A are Thermistor Mount/Power Splitter combinations used as feed­through standards for the calibration of terminating power sensors such as bolometer mounts and po wer meters .

Models F1119H and F1109H are Thermistor Mount/ Attenuator/Power Splitter combinations used as feed­through standards for the calibration of higher power terminating sensors. The use of the attenuator/splitter combination provides a broader band, lower SWR device . Use of either Model, along with the Model 1805B and a suitable source of power enables calibration of 1W to 5W terminating sensors directly at a power level within their normal operating range.
Models M1111, M1120, M1110 and M1118 are terminating power standards capable of calibration directly by NIST, and ar e used f or the calibration of feed­through devices such as RF power meters, bolometer mount-coupler and bolometer mount-splitter assemblies , and in other configurations requiring dir ect measurement of RF power.

Models 1807A, F1119C and F1117AC are feed-through mounts pr ovided with a case (figure 3) simplifying setup configurations requiring a precision power standard and a highly stable RF signal level all in one package. This package protects the individual components mounted within the unit from damage due to mishandling as can happen with other RF transfer standards. A pull-out shelf located in the bottom of the unit is pro vided for use as a work platform when calibrating power sensors and power meter mounts or f or the transfer of calibration factors.

NIST CALIBRATION: Calibration Factors only for the Models M1110, M1111 and M1118 Terminating Mounts can be supplied directly by the National Institute of Standards and Technology.
RACK MOUNTING: Models 1807A, F1119C and F1117AC are half-rack instruments that can be mounted in any cabinet or rack designed according to EIA RS-310 and MIL-STD-189 using the Rack Adapter Kit (P/N 1919). This kit allows any of the models to be mounted with the model 1805B, or another coaxial power standard in the same rack-mount configuration.
